MOTHER KNOWS BEST?
After reading Nightcrawlers #1 (and after Legion of X), I can safely say that of the four Essex clones, Mother Righteous is my favorite.
Tumblr media
But that's not really saying much, is it?
That's like asking, "Who's your favorite fascist dictator?" or "Which plague was your favorite?"
And it's not even like it's a matter of choosing the Lesser or Four Evils, because I don't for a second believe that she's the least evil of the four of them. By all accounts of what we've been shown, I'd go so far as to say she's probably the most evil, using Faith as both a weapon and a collar for her followers, getting them to believe in something as she uses them to accomplish Her goals.
Tumblr media
She's perfectly willing to manipulate the faith of the Nightcrawler clones and paint herself as a holy figure while demonizing everyone else, including Storm.
In her own words, she works for nobody but herself.
Tumblr media
As would benefit any version of Nathaniel Essex.
But I think the reason I like her best is her lack of Ego... or, at the very least, her lack of Vanity. She's under no illusion or self delusions about being the original Essex and has quickly cast that element that so plagues the other three aside.
Tumblr media
But that, in turn, I think is what makes her the most dangerous.
She very easily moved past her own vanity and set about accomplishing her own goals. She's not overcome with the desire to paint the universe with her own face (♦️) or rid humanity of mutants(♣️), or achieve Dominion (♠️). Granted, we don't know what her plans are at the moment, aside from the fact that she wants to reset the timeline, but to what end we don't know.
What we do know is that, like the other Essex, she is perfectly fine with sacrificing others to accomplish those ends. Like Sinister during his attempts to assassinate the Quiet Council, she's willing to use this Legion to her own ends.
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
R.I.P. Wallcrawler, we hardly knew ye.
The only person I currently see wising up to her shenanigans is Banshee/Vox Ignis. Sean's already suspicious of her methods and the Spirit of Variance seems to be coming around that not everything is on the up'n'up with their Holy Mother.
Tumblr media
At the end of the day, we know that when the Sins of Sinister ends, she will end up working with the other three Essex Clones, probably because everyone will be coming for them after all the shit that's going to go down by the time we reach the year 1000.
Tumblr media
Either way, I'm not only looking forward to seeing how this all plays out, but to seeing more of Mother Righteous herself. Maybe in a more magic-based setting?

more super fun facts about sukuna that are lost in translation that i'll incorporate occasionally in my writing of replies ! this man speaks in ancient , out dated japanese at times , it's a verbal tic that one can use to distinguish his way of speaking from someone else's , like yuji's casual , modern way . not only his vocal tone being deeper , but his terms are strictly outdated . he uses old idioms , exchanges words , and borrows from poems and haikus . - sukuna's use if the word " misete " , translated in english as " enchant me , compel me , fascinate me " . he's saying " show me what you've got , fushiguro megumi ! " in oudated tongue , challenging him to go all out with his shikigami . he uses this again later to mahogara , shouting at it that it no longer obeys megumi or the zen'in , it obeys him and him alone . - the word " keikatsu " is a word he uses in chapter 3 , super early on . now , the word " keikatsu " is ancient , and stolen from a chinese poem almost 2 - 3 thousand years ago , not only proving he was sentient these past 1000 years , but also proving that he's quite the consumer of art . the original poem goes like this : " to live or to die , together or apart , you and i , we've made an oath , to hold hand in hand , until we're old " . this is part of the binding vow he makes with yuji to return him to life . - he uses " shiremono " , which would sound super ancient to anyone speaking modern japanese . no one even says " shiremono " anymore , they use the more typical and common " baka " for " idiot " . sukuna's talking in a tongue only cultured or experienced sorcerers might understand . mahito , who he's saying this to , wouldn't grasp the outdated nature of the word , if he even knows it at all . - in chapter 199 , he calls himself " the disgraced one / the fallen one " using " daten " daten implies " fallen ( from heaven ) " , and the later " datenshi " is " fallen angel " . angel's purpose as a " tenshi ( angel ) " is to banish " datenshi " or the fallen angel . again , this is less common tongue , and in modern tongue , it means to strike . - yorozo mentions that she'll " create a haiku " , and it goes as follows : even the handsome boys get flaky when hung to dry , but it sure is cute " . upon sukuna hearing it , he cringes and makes a face before asking " kigo wa ? " which is " where's the seasonal word ? " , implying that she's bad at writing haiku . haiku is 5-7-5 , with " seasonal words " or kigo . - when talking with uraume , he mentions ( in english ) " as always , your hands help reach the right spot for me " . this is in reference to scrubbing someone's back in a japanese bath , which means that he and uraume are exceptionally close , that uraume is his assistant . - he calls gojo a " nameless fish " , using " uo " , an ancient word for fish . he also calls the fingerbearer " orosu " , similarly . sukuna speaks in a distinctive way compared to yuji's modern lingo and megumi's refined way of speaking . sukuna uses ancient vocabulary. someone like gojo and megumi might understand the implications of these words , but it also shows that sukuna sees jujutsu as an art he is extremely passionate about perfecting . cooking , haiku making , poetry , sukuna himself isn't a brute through and through , he was once very refined & carries that knowledge into today .

Litecoin price prediction: What will be the expected price on 2025?
Litecoin (LTC) is a cryptocurrency created from a fork on the Bitcoin blockchain in 2011. It was originally designed to address developers' concerns that Bitcoin was becoming more centralized and to make it more difficult for large mining companies to gain a upper hand in mining. Although in the end it stopped mining companies taking the lion's share of Litecoin mining, the cryptocurrency has reinvented itself into a mineable coin and a peer-to-peer payment system. Like bitcoin, litecoin is a form of digital currency. Using blockchain technology, Litecoin can be used to transfer funds directly between individuals or businesses. This ensures that the public accounts of all transactions are recorded and allows the fund to operate a seamless payment system without government oversight or scrutiny.
Tumblr media
 Litecoin (LTC) is an off spring of Bitcoin cryptocurrency created by Charlie Lee in 2011. Litecoin is designed to enable low-cost peer-to-peer payments. It is one of the top 5 cryptocurrencies by market capitalization.
Litecoin market captitalization?
Litecoin market capitalization at the beginning of 2020 was the highest on record, more than 10 billion US dollars and the value increased by 100% since August 2020. The market cap is calculated by multiplying the number of Litecoins distributed by the price of Litecoin. However, when compared to Bitcoin's market cap and Ethereum's market cap, Litecoin's number is relatively small. Trading history of Litecoin?
There have been some interesting moments in the long history of Litecoin price, and if you want to know more about its movements, you have come to the right place. We've compiled everything you need to know about Litecoin's past price action - and various factors affecting it.
After its launch, Litecoin's growth was aided by its availability and increased liquidity in early exchanges such as BTC-e. During the month of November 2013, the absolute value of Litecoin experienced a huge growth that included a 100% increase in 24 hours.
When Litecoin was first introduced in 2011, two years after Bitcoin, it gained momentum and reached a price per coin of $0.30. By mid-November 2013, Litecoin's price had risen above $4, then in less than a week, it had risen over 1000% to a high of around $50. This was followed, however, by a sudden crash below $10 and the previous high would not move for a few years.
